Here’s the simple breakdown of who Steve Young played for across his pro career:
- Los Angeles Express (USFL): 1984–1985
- Tampa Bay Buccaneers (NFL): 1985–1986
- San Francisco 49ers (NFL): 1987–1999
Among these, he is best known for his long run with the 49ers, where he became a Hall of Fame quarterback and a Super Bowl–winning star.
